An online master's degree is a fully online programme that allows international students to pursue their postgraduate studies without the need to relocate. These programmes offer unparalleled flexibility, enabling students to study from anywhere in the world. Whether you're balancing work commitments, family responsibilities, or simply prefer the convenience of remote learning, an online master's degree provides the adaptability you need. In our system, any master’s programme that is entirely delivered online is considered an online master's degree. This means you can access high-quality education from top universities without geographical constraints. The benefits of pursuing an online master's programme are numerous. You enjoy the flexibility to study at your own pace, the convenience of learning from any location, and the ability to balance your studies with work or other commitments. Additionally, you often save on living and commuting costs, making it a cost-effective option. The primary difference between an online master degree and an on-campus master's degree lies in the mode of delivery and flexibility. On-campus programmes require physical attendance at classes, offering a traditional learning experience with direct interaction with professors and peers. In contrast, online master's degrees allow students to study from anywhere in the world, providing flexibility that is ideal for working professionals or those with other commitments. Online programmes often use a variety of digital tools and platforms to facilitate learning, including video lectures, discussion forums, and virtual classrooms. While on-campus degrees may offer more immediate social interactions, online degrees provide the convenience of studying at your own pace and schedule.
